In the rapidly evolving world of data analytics, effectively managing data is just as important as analysing it. A crucial element often overlooked is the data dictionary—a centralised reference that provides detailed information about every data element in a system. For professionals and aspiring data experts in Pune, mastering the creation and maintenance of practical data dictionaries is essential to ensuring data quality, consistency, and usability across projects.
Whether you are a seasoned analyst or someone currently enrolled in a data analyst course, understanding the significance of a well-maintained data dictionary is a skill that can dramatically improve your efficiency and the accuracy of your insights.
What is a Data Dictionary, and Why Does it Matter?
A data dictionary is a metadata repository that comprehensively describes all the data fields used in a database or dataset, including their meanings, formats, allowed values, and relationships with other data elements. This documentation is a single source of truth for everyone who interacts with the data—be it data engineers, analysts, developers, or business stakeholders.
Companies handle vast volumes of data daily in Pune’s burgeoning tech landscape. Teams often face misinterpretations, duplicate efforts, and data errors without a proper data dictionary. This inefficiency can be costly, especially when rapid, data-driven decisions are crucial. That is why learning to build and maintain data dictionaries is a key module in any data analyst course, emphasising practical skills that enable better data governance and collaboration.
Benefits of Effective Data Dictionaries for Pune’s Data Community
For Pune’s data professionals, a practical data dictionary brings multiple benefits:
- Improved Communication: It ensures everyone speaks the same data language, minimising misunderstandings between technical and business teams.
- Enhanced Data Quality: Clear definitions prevent inconsistent data entries and errors.
- Faster Onboarding: New team members can understand datasets quickly without relying on word-of-mouth or guesswork.
- Easier Compliance: Proper documentation aids in meeting regulatory requirements and auditing.
- Scalability: A data dictionary helps maintain order and clarity as datasets grow.
Professionals pursuing a data analyst course in Pune gain hands-on experience in building such dictionaries, preparing them for real-world challenges businesses face in this rapidly expanding market.
Best Practices for Creating Effective Data Dictionaries
1. Define the Purpose and Scope Clearly
Before you start documenting, understand why you need the data dictionary. Is it for a single project, an entire system, or the whole organisation? The scope determines the detail level you include and your approach.
2. Include All Relevant Metadata
Each data element should be accompanied by detailed metadata, including:
- Name of the data field
- Description or definition
- Data type (string, integer, date, etc.)
- Format and length restrictions
- Allowed values or ranges (for categorical or numeric data)
- Source or origin of the data
- Relationships to other data elements
- Business rules or usage notes
This comprehensive approach ensures no ambiguity in interpretation.
3. Adopt Consistent Naming Conventions
Consistency in naming conventions is key to a usable data dictionary. Establish and enforce standards that describe how names should be formed—whether camelCase, snake_case, or another format—ensuring uniformity across datasets. This practice simplifies searching and referencing, essential when multiple teams interact with the same data.
4. Collaborate with Cross-Functional Teams
Data dictionaries should not be developed in isolation. Engage with data owners, developers, analysts, and business users to gather accurate information. Their input ensures the dictionary reflects real usage and business context, reducing errors and omissions.
5. Use Technology to Your Advantage
Many tools are available that facilitate creating and maintaining data dictionaries, from simple spreadsheets to advanced metadata management software. Automation tools can extract metadata directly from databases, reducing manual effort and keeping documentation current. Pune-based organisations can explore these tools as part of their data governance strategy.
Maintaining Your Data Dictionary: Keys to Longevity
Creating a data dictionary is only half the job; maintaining it is equally important. Here are some best practices for keeping your data dictionary effective over time:
1. Schedule Regular Updates
Data environments evolve continuously. New data fields are added, formats are changed, and business rules are updated. Setting a schedule to review and revise your data dictionary ensures it stays relevant and accurate.
2. Implement Access Controls and Version Management
To protect the integrity of the dictionary, control who can make changes. Version control helps track modifications and allows you to revert to previous versions if necessary.
3. Promote Usage and Awareness
Even the best data dictionary is useless if people don’t use it. Conduct training sessions and workshops to demonstrate its value and how to use it effectively. This is especially relevant for students enrolled in a data analyst course in Pune, where adopting practical skills can make a big difference in their career readiness.
4. Integrate with Data Governance and Quality Initiatives
A data dictionary should be a core component of your organisation’s data governance framework. To maximise its impact, align it with data quality policies, privacy guidelines, and compliance requirements.
Challenges and How to Overcome Them
Creating and maintaining a data dictionary isn’t without challenges. Common obstacles include:
- Resistance to Documentation: Teams may see it as extra work. Emphasise the long-term benefits to encourage buy-in.
- Rapid Data Changes: Fast-evolving data environments make it hard to keep documentation current. Automate updates where possible.
- Lack of Ownership: Without clear responsibility, dictionaries can become outdated. Assign data stewards to manage and champion the dictionary.
In Pune’s fast-paced IT environment, addressing these challenges head-on ensures smoother data operations.
The Importance of Data Documentation Skills in Pune
As Pune grows as a technology and analytics hub, the demand for professionals skilled in data documentation and management increases. Whether you aim to switch careers or enhance your current role, gaining expertise in creating and maintaining data dictionaries is invaluable.
Enrolling offers structured learning to build these competencies from scratch. Many Pune-based institutes incorporate real-world projects that include metadata documentation, preparing students for workplace realities.
Final Thoughts
Effective data management is a prerequisite for success in the age of big data. Data dictionaries are foundational in this process, enabling better data quality, communication, and governance.
For Pune’s data professionals and learners, mastering the art of creating and maintaining data dictionaries will boost career prospects and organisational value. Pune’s data community can significantly improve their data management frameworks by following best practices, defining clear objectives, standardising metadata, collaborating with stakeholders, and committing to regular updates.
If you’re eager to build practical skills and deepen your understanding, consider enrolling in a reputable course. These programs provide hands-on experience and prepare you to contribute effectively to any data-driven organisation.
Business Name: ExcelR – Data Science, Data Analyst Course Training
Address: 1st Floor, East Court Phoenix Market City, F-02, Clover Park, Viman Nagar, Pune, Maharashtra 411014
Phone Number: 096997 53213
Email Id: enquiry@excelr.com
